Best Practices
The Problem: AI can’t fix broken processes—it just accelerates them. 70% of manufacturers still rely on manual data collection, leading to errors and inefficiencies (according to Forbes).
Actionable Steps: - Audit existing workflows to identify bottlenecks, conflicting data sources, and manual workarounds. - Unify order intake systems to eliminate "multiple versions of the truth." - Document processes before AI implementation to ensure smooth integration.
Example: A corrugated box manufacturer reduced order errors by 40% after standardizing their intake process before deploying AI.
The Opportunity: The corrugated packaging market is growing at a CAGR of 4.1%, driven by e-commerce demand (as reported by Towards Packaging).
Actionable Steps: - Use AI-driven forecasting to predict demand and optimize stock levels. - Automate reorder points to reduce raw material waste. - Integrate with ERP systems for real-time inventory tracking.
Example: Lenovo’s AI scheduling cut planning time from two hours to two minutes, boosting production by 19% (Forbes).
The Challenge: Generic AI struggles with geospatial data, leading to routing errors (SCMR).
Actionable Steps: - Use AI with location intelligence (e.g., HERE Technologies) for accurate tracking. - Automate delivery route optimization to reduce last-mile inefficiencies. - Collect real-world driver feedback to refine AI routing models.
Example: Saving 30 seconds per delivery stop can add five extra deliveries per day (SCMR).
The Solution: AI-powered robotics achieve 99% first-pick success in unstructured environments (Teradyne Robotics).
Actionable Steps: - Deploy AI vision systems for automated picking and packing. - Integrate with warehouse management systems for real-time tracking. - Use AI to handle dynamic inventory shifts (e.g., misplaced boxes).
Example: Vention’s Rapid Operator AI reduces manual labor in warehouses while improving accuracy (Teradyne Robotics).
The Risk: Bad data becomes worse with AI—95% of AI pilots fail due to poor data quality (Forbes).
Actionable Steps: - Clean and standardize data sources before AI integration. - Use AI for data validation (e.g., flagging discrepancies). - Train teams on data hygiene to maintain accuracy.
Example: A manufacturer cut order errors by 50% after implementing AI-driven data validation.

Hook: Struggling with delayed order confirmations, misfiled shipments, or poor tracking visibility? You're not alone. AI can transform your corrugated box business's order processing and tracking. Here are seven signs it's time to embrace AI-driven workflows.
Sign 1: Multiple Versions of the Truth - Problem: Inconsistent data across ERP, spreadsheets, and employee memory leads to errors and delays. - AI Solution: Unify data sources and automate data entry to ensure a single, accurate version of the truth.
Sign 2: Manual Data Collection - Problem: Manual data collection is slow, error-prone, and labor-intensive. - AI Solution: Automate data collection using AI-powered forms, bots, or optical character recognition (OCR) to reduce errors and speed up processes.
Sign 3: Siloed Operations - Problem: Disconnected tools and workflows lead to inefficiencies, delays, and poor communication. - AI Solution: Integrate AI-driven workflow automation to connect tools, streamline processes, and improve communication across departments.
Sign 4: Delayed Order Confirmations - Problem: Slow order confirmation processes lead to customer dissatisfaction and potential lost sales. - AI Solution: Implement AI-powered order intake and routing systems to accelerate order confirmation and reduce response times.
Sign 5: Misfiled Shipments - Problem: Manual data entry and file management can result in misfiled shipments, leading to customer complaints and increased costs. - AI Solution: Automate file management and use AI-driven quality control to reduce misfiling and improve shipment accuracy.
Sign 6: Poor Tracking Visibility - Problem: Lack of real-time tracking visibility makes it difficult to monitor order status, address issues proactively, and ensure timely delivery. - AI Solution: Deploy AI-driven tracking systems that provide real-time order status updates, automated alerts, and proactive issue resolution.
Sign 7: Struggling with Last-Meter Delivery - Problem: Complex routing, parking, and access point challenges can hinder last-mile delivery, leading to delays and customer dissatisfaction. - AI Solution: Adopt specialized "location reasoning" AI for complex routing scenarios, real-time driver feedback integration, and dynamic route optimization to improve last-mile delivery efficiency.
